Hi, Has anyone used 2 USRPs to simultaneously receive 4 different frequencies using DBSRX cards? I just wanted to check the correct way of linking it all up. As I understand it the correct combination is:
fg=gr.flow_graph() u0=usrp.source_c(0,decim,2,0,0) u1=usrp.source_c(1,decim,2,0,0) u0.set_mux(0x00003210) u1.set_mux(0x00003210) tune_result0=usrp.tune(u0,0,usrp.selected_subdev(u,(0,0)),freq0) tune_result1=usrp.tune(u0,1,(1,0),freq1) tune_result2=usrp.tune(u1,0,(0,0),freq2) tune_result3=usrp.tune(u1,1,(1,0),freq3) de_inter0 = gr.deinterleave(gr.sizeof_gr_complex) de_inter1 = gr.deinterleave(gr.sizeof_gr_complex) fg.connect(u0,de_inter0) fg.connect((de_inter0,0), ...) fg.connect((de_inter0,1), ...) fg.connect(u1,de_inter1) fg.connect((de_inter1,0), ...) fg.connect((de_inter1,1), ...) Is the mux correct for this? Or do I need to do something else to ensure the correct DDC works on the correct channel? Cheers, Toby _______________________________________________ Discuss-gnuradio mailing list Discuss-gnuradio@gnu.org http://lists.gnu.org/mailman/listinfo/discuss-gnuradio